    7 Tasty Keto Friendly Cocktails

    Published: Dec 12, 2022 Modified: Dec 12, 2022 by Karen Kelly This post may contain affiliate links.

    woman holding a cocktail

    The Ketogenic Diet is a low-carbohydrate method of eating that has helped people lose weight while experiencing other health benefits, such as lowering blood pressure and improving mood and energy. So what do people on keto do when they desire a libation? 

    woman with cocktail

    Keto-Friendly Alcoholic Beverages

    If you're following a keto diet, there are still plenty of low-carb alcoholic beverages that you may enjoy in moderation. For example, pure forms of liquor, including vodka, rum whiskey, gin, brandy, scotch, and tequila, are entirely carbohydrate-free.

    So you can enjoy these liquors straight up (neat), on the rocks, or combined with low-carb mixers for more sophisticated flavors. Dry wines and low-carb beers can also be drunk in moderation on keto. 

    Per the CDC, a standard alcoholic beverage is equal to 14.0 grams (0.6 ounces) of pure alcohol found in:

    • 12 ounces of beer (5% alcohol content).
    • 8 ounces of malt liquor (7% alcohol content).
    • 5 ounces of wine (12% alcohol content).
    • 1.5 ounces of 80-proof (40% alcohol content) distilled spirits or liquor (rum, gin, vodka, tequila, brandy, whiskey).

    Keto-Friendly Mixers

    Low-carb mixers, including sugar-free tonic water, seltzer, diet soda, flavored sugar-free sparkling water, powdered drink packets, and soda water, are all viable mixers for your keto diet. 

    Additionally, you can use sugar-free syrups to sweeten drinks for fancier flavors. Avoid sugary mixers such as juice, soda, and energy drinks. Here are a handful of popular keto-friendly alcoholic beverages found on Reddit.

    1. Skinny Mojitos

    A Skinny Mojito is a deliciously refreshing alternative to straight liquor. All you need is your preference for white rum, diet 7-UP, lime juice, and fresh mint. Many people agree that Skinny Mojitos are a hit. 

    2. Keto Frozen Margaritas

    For good Frozen Margaritas, you'll need sugar-free lemonade, fresh lime juice, tequila, and ice. Toss into the blender, and voila! You can substitute Smirnoff Orange Vodka if you prefer flavored. 

    A shot has 0.5 net carbs. Alternatively, Absolut or Burnett's Raspberry vodkas have 0 net carbs per 240ml serving and are acceptable. Because strawberries are moderately allowed as part of a keto diet, tossing a few frozen ones in the blender makes this drink tastier. 

    3. Keto Lime Margarita on the Rocks

    Sipping a traditional lime margarita-flavored drink is doable on keto. All you need is Tequila, soda water, and a dash of lime juice or a squeeze of fresh lime. You can also use Erythritol as a substitute for Triple Sec, but it’s unnecessary.

    Salt the rim, and it's a diet margarita! Alternatively, you can use Crystal Light sparkling lime drops or powdered packets to create a refreshing citrus taste. Sugar-free margarita mixers also exist.  

    4. Keto Orange Creamsicle

    To enjoy the delicious taste of an orange creamsicle, you'll need 1.5 ounces of vodka, 2 ounces of heavy whipping cream, a dash (¼ tsp.) of vanilla and orange extracts, and 4 ounces of diet orange soda. 

    Alternatively, you can skip the soda and orange extract and substitute orange Mio drops and lime Lao Croix sparkling water. Warning: there are conflicting reports online about using whipped cream vodka on keto. However, whipped cream vodka has carbs, so read the labels!

    5. Keto Sangria

    For a delicious keto spin on Sangria, combine a quarter packet of Fruit Punch Crystal Light with equal parts dry red wine and club soda. Serve over ice, garnish with a few raspberries, and voila, keto-friendly Sangria that tastes like dessert!

    6. Keto Lemon Drop Martini

    For a simple but refreshing drink, keto-friendly Lemon Drop Martinis are it. It requires a martini shaker for optimal results. 

    Add vodka, lemon-flavored sugar-free sparkling water, three tablespoons of freshly squeezed lemon juice, and a tablespoon of Erythritol or Monk Fruit sweetener. Shake for at least 45 seconds to ensure the sweetener dissolves, and enjoy!

    7. Keto Moscow Mule

    A keto-friendly Moscow Mule is a refreshing cocktail served best in its traditional copper cup. Add ⅛ teaspoon of raw ginger root, a teaspoon of fresh lime juice, and mint leaves (optional), and muddle the ingredients in the cup. 

    You can use a wooden spoon if you don't have a traditional muddler. Then, add ice, vodka, and a slow pour of lime-flavored sparkling water or seltzer. 

    Alternatively, people substitute keto-friendly ginger beer instead of lime-flavored sparkling water and raw ginger. Both are keto-friendly options for enjoying an alcoholic beverage without breaking your diet.
